Dyspatch vs SendGrid: What are the differences?
Dyspatch: Dyspatch is an email production platform that helps Enterprise organizations create & change transactional and triggered emails faster. Dyspatch is an email production platform that helps Enterprise organizations create and change transactional and triggered emails faster, by centralizing template creation, approval, and publishing processes. The powerful API, visual editor, and built-in device testing allow for cutting-edge email strategy and execution while helping establish consistency in both branding and legal compliance across multiple teams, departments, and business units; SendGrid: Email Delivery. Simplified. SendGrid's cloud-based email infrastructure relieves businesses of the cost and complexity of maintaining custom email systems. SendGrid provides reliable delivery, scalability and real-time analytics along with flexible API's that make custom integration a breeze.
Dyspatch and SendGrid can be categorized as "Transactional Email" tools.
Some of the features offered by Dyspatch are:
- Easy, Visual Template Editing
- Flexible Localization Support
- Shareable Content Between Templates Through Reusable Code Blocks
On the other hand, SendGrid provides the following key features:
- Open Tracking
- Click Tracking
- Unsubscribe Tracking
